Hi @angeliz, just as there are different types of wine, there are a wide variety of grapes used in producing them. The grapes vary from country to country and region to region, but they are either a white grape or a red grape.
The best red grapes for making high quality wine include;
*Barbera, found in Italy and California
*Cabernet franc
*Cabernet Sauvignon
*Gamay
*Grenache
*Merlot
*Pinot Noir, also known as Burgundy
*Sangiovese
*Syrah/Shiraz
*Zinfandel
Some of the White Grapes that make the best wines includes;
*Chardonnay
*Chenin blanc, which is also known as Vouvray in France
*Colombard
*Gewurztraminer
*Pinot Gris, which is also known as Pinot Grigio in Italy
*Riesling
*Sauvignon Blanc, which is also known as Fume Blanc
*Trebbiano
*Viognier
These grapes are grown in different parts of the world.
